Technical Field
The utility model relates to the technical field of dispersion machines, in particular to a dispersion machine which is used for processing epoxy resin and is convenient for later maintenance.
Background
Dispersers are also known as blenders. The device can be divided into a hydraulic lifting disperser and a mechanical lifting disperser according to different lifting forms, the speed of the disperser can be adjusted at will and mainly comprises a hydraulic system, a main transmission, a stirring system, a guide mechanism and an electric cabinet, each part has a compact and reasonable structure and is widely applied to efficient equipment for stirring and dispersing and dissolving coatings, paints, pigments, adhesives and other chemical products, common types comprise an emulsion disperser, an explosion-proof disperser, a lifting disperser, a stirring disperser, a paint disperser and the like, for the disperser applied to epoxy resin processing, in the stirring and using process of the disperser, because a stirring mechanism on the disperser is in a vertically downward state, when the mechanism on the disperser has small faults and is used for a long time, the disperser needs to be maintained and overhauled, but when most of the existing dispersers are in a vertical state, the operator needs the health to carry out difficult bending and removal when maintaining and repairing, causes the operator to waste time and energy, also leads to the low scheduling problem of operating efficiency when maintaining the dispenser.

Referring to fig. 1, the present invention provides a new technical solution: the utility model provides a dispenser for epoxy processing later maintenance of being convenient for, the on-line screen storage device comprises a base 1, base 1's upside fixedly connected with first backup pad 2 and second backup pad 3, first backup pad 2 is located the rear side of second backup pad 3, the opposite side of first backup pad 2 and second backup pad 3 is provided with dispenser 4, dispenser 4 is current structure, do not do too much repeated here, can disperse the stirring with the epoxy in the agitator under the control of external power supply through utilizing dispenser 4, and then guarantee that epoxy can obtain effectual separation.
Referring to fig. 1-2, a rotating column 5 is fixedly connected to a left side of a first support plate 2, an expansion slot 6 is formed in the left side of the first support plate 2 and located above the rotating column 5, a sliding slot 8 is formed in a right side of the first support plate 2, the first support plate 2 is defined by the rotating column 5 and the sliding slot 8, the first support plate 2 is divided into an upper portion and a lower portion of the first support plate 2, a positioning plate 7 is fixedly connected to a left side of the lower portion of the first support plate 2, the upper portion of the first support plate 2 and the lower portion of the first support plate 2 can rotate ninety degrees by the rotating column 5 by using the rotation of the first support plate 2 and the rotating column 5, the positioning plate 7 serves to limit when the upper portion of the first support plate 2 is vertically butted against the lower portion of the first support plate 2, and thus avoiding the disadvantage of the rotation transition of the upper portion of the first support plate 2, the accuracy of the coincidence butt joint of the upper part of the first supporting plate 2 and the lower part of the first supporting plate 2 is guaranteed.
Referring to fig. 3, a supporting device is disposed inside the sliding chute 8, the supporting device includes a sliding plate 9, a surface of the sliding plate 9 is slidably connected inside the sliding chute 8, a connecting rod 10 is fixedly connected to a right side of the sliding plate 9, the sliding chute 8 and the sliding plate 9 are both triangular, a connecting groove 11 is formed in a right side of the first supporting plate 2, a left side of the connecting rod 10 is slidably connected inside the connecting groove 11, an elastic spring 12 is slidably sleeved on a surface of the connecting rod 10, left and right ends of the elastic spring 12 are respectively fixedly connected to a left end of the connecting rod 10 and inside the connecting groove 11, after the upper portion of the first supporting plate 2 is overlapped with the lower portion of the first supporting plate 2, the connecting rod 10 is stretched by the elastic spring 12 which is extruded and stretched, the elastic spring 12 drives the connecting rod 10 to move leftward inside the connecting groove 11, and the connecting rod 10 drives the sliding plate 9 to enter inside the sliding chute 8, spout 8 and slide 9's triangle-shaped is for when the upper portion of first backup pad 2 and the lower part of first backup pad 2 bend, the triangle face of slide 9 can be extruded to the upper portion of first backup pad 2, and then slide on the inner wall of spout 8 through the triangle face of slide 9, the gliding convenience of slide 9 is extruded to the lower part of the upper portion of first backup pad 2 and first backup pad 2 has been ensured, the flexibility that the upper portion of first backup pad 2 and the lower part of first backup pad 2 butt joint and bend has been ensured.
Referring to fig. 3-4, a moving groove 13 is formed on the right side of the first support plate 2, a limit rod 14 is fixedly connected inside the moving groove 13, a limit plate 15 is slidably connected on the surface of the limit rod 14, a fixed spring 16 is slidably sleeved on the surface of the limit rod 14, the upper end and the lower end of the fixed spring 16 are respectively fixedly connected on the inner wall of the moving groove 13 and the upper side of the limit plate 15, a fixed plate 17 is fixedly connected on the right side of the limit plate 15, a handle 18 is rotatably connected on the upper side of the fixed plate 17, a handle platform 19 is fixedly connected on the right side of the first support plate 2, the handle platform 19 is positioned above the fixed plate 17 and the handle 18, the handle 18 and the handle platform 19 are respectively in an L shape and a concave shape, a fixed groove 20 is formed on the upper side of the sliding plate 9, the lower side of the fixed plate 17 is slidably clamped inside the fixed groove 20, and after the upper portion of the first support plate 2 is overlapped and butted with the lower portion of the first support plate 2, after the sliding plate 9 is driven by the elastic spring 12 to move leftwards to be matched and butted with the sliding groove 8, the L-shaped handle 18 is rotated out from the inside of the concave-shaped handle platform 19, the concave shape of the handle platform 19 is used for matching and placing the L-shaped handle 18, the stability of placing the handle 18 in the inside of the handle platform 19 is ensured, when the handle platform 19 does not limit the handle 18, the fixing spring 16 which is compressed to deform is used for pushing the limiting plate 15 to descend in the inside of the moving groove 13 under the self elastic force of the fixing spring 16, the limiting plate 15 and the limiting rod 14 are used for limiting the fixing plate 17, the fixing plate 17 is prevented from being separated from the surface of the first supporting plate 2 to slide, and then the lower side of the fixing plate 17 enters the inside of the fixing groove 20, the mode ensures the convenience of maintaining and overhauling of the disperser 4 at the upper part of the first supporting plate 2 after the upper part of the first supporting plate 2 is bent with the lower part of the first supporting plate 2, avoided most dispenser 4 to be the complexity of the maintenance of being not convenient for of vertical state, can carry out quick keeping flat when having ensured dispenser 4 maintenance, and then improved the simplicity to dispenser 4 maintenance, reduced the loaded down with trivial details nature that wastes time and energy of operator's maintenance when dispenser 4 is vertical state, also ensured simultaneously that the upper portion of first backup pad 2 and the lower part of first backup pad 2 carry out quick bending and the sensitivity of butt joint.
The working principle is as follows: a dispersion machine for processing epoxy resin and facilitating later maintenance is characterized in that after the upper portion of a first support plate 2 is overlapped with the lower portion of the first support plate 2, a connecting rod 10 is stretched through extrusion and stretching, under the action of the elastic force of the elastic spring 12, the elastic spring 12 drives the connecting rod 10 to move leftwards in a connecting groove 11, the connecting rod 10 drives a sliding plate 9 to enter the inside of the sliding groove 8, the triangular shapes of the sliding groove 8 and the sliding plate 9 are such that when the upper portion of the first support plate 2 is bent with the lower portion of the first support plate 2, the upper portion of the first support plate 2 can extrude the triangular surface of the sliding plate 9, the sliding plate slides on the inner wall of the sliding groove 8 through the triangular surface of the sliding plate 9, after the upper portion of the first support plate 2 is overlapped and butted with the lower portion of the first support plate 2, the sliding plate 9 is driven by the elastic spring 12 to move leftwards and butted with the sliding groove 8, the L-shaped handle 18 is rotated out in the concave handle platform 19, the fixing spring 16 which is compressed to deform pushes the limiting plate 15 to descend in the moving groove 13 under the elastic force of the fixing spring 16, the limiting plate 15 and the limiting rod 14 are used for limiting the fixing plate 17, the fixing plate 17 is prevented from being separated from the surface of the first supporting plate 2 to slide, and then the lower side of the fixing plate 17 enters the fixing groove 20.
